Mechanical properties of fasteners – Bolts, screws and studs (ISO 898-1 : 1988) English version of DIN EN 20 898 Part 1
This part of ISO 898 specifies the mechanical properties of bolts, screws and studs when tested at room temperature (see ISO 1) . Properties will vary at higher and lower temperature.
